Last time I had an oxygen sensor alarm, I contacted Honda and found out that depending upon your serial number, there is a "kit" for replacing the sensor and "reseting" the parameters for the alarm.

Mine needed the new sensor, a replacement manifold, and the "flash" of the computer for the new parameters. Essentially, Honda told me the alarm is a "false" alarm and with the parameters now being larger, you shouldn't get an alarm

No problem since "the kit".
